AKAP Bus Pool in Kramatjati Market Gets Harsh Criticism

The use of Kramatjati Market area as an AKAP bus pool gets harsh criticism from Head of Jakarta Transportation Department, Andri Yansyah. Yansyah asserted, all AKAP buses should get into terminal, instead of making illegal terminal. Because of that, he intends to control buses that park in such area.

This is illegal action you know, in which the traditional market is not a terminal

He will also send a letter to the market management not to give permission to the AKAP bus. The letter itself would be copied to Jakarta Governor, Basuki Tjahaja Purnama (Ahok).

"This is illegal action you know, in which the traditional market is not a terminal. Certainly, I'll do strict action towards the buses that still park passengers around the market, starting from written warning until ticketing," he stressed, Saturday (7/25).
